The Future of Global B2B Wholesale: Trends and Innovations
The B2B wholesale landscape is rapidly evolving, driven by technology and changing market demands. As businesses navigate this dynamic environment, understanding emerging trends and innovations is essential for remaining competitive and meeting customer expectations.
Rise of E-commerce in B2B Wholesale
One of the most significant trends reshaping the B2B wholesale industry is the rise of e-commerce. More businesses are adopting online platforms to facilitate transactions, making it easier for suppliers and manufacturers to reach a global audience. E-commerce allows for 24/7 access to products, which is increasingly important in today's fast-paced business environment.
Integration of Artificial Intelligence and Data Analytics
Artificial intelligence (AI) and data analytics are becoming vital tools for B2B wholesalers. AI-driven solutions can enhance decision-making by providing insights into customer behavior, inventory management, and market trends. By leveraging these technologies, businesses can make informed decisions that drive efficiency and profitability.
Focus on Sustainability
As global awareness about sustainability increases, B2B wholesalers must adapt to new expectations from customers. Companies that prioritize sustainable practices and transparent supply chains are likely to gain a competitive edge. This includes sourcing products responsibly and minimizing environmental impact during the manufacturing and shipping processes.
The Importance of Personalization
Personalization is not just a trend in B2C; it is becoming increasingly important in B2B wholesale as well. Businesses that tailor their offerings to meet the specific needs of their clients can build stronger relationships and enhance customer loyalty. Utilizing customer data to provide personalized experiences can set your business apart in a crowded market.
Enhanced Supply Chain Resilience
The COVID-19 pandemic highlighted the vulnerabilities in global supply chains. As a result, B2B wholesalers are reevaluating their supply chain strategies to enhance resilience. Diversifying suppliers and implementing robust risk management plans are crucial steps in ensuring continuity in operations.
